> How do I select a fragment of my molecule when there sequence numbers
> are not consecutive? For example, I want to select residue 1-50,
> 75-100, and 150-200 together. Thanks.
Depends what you want to do with your fragment. You can't refine or
regularize such a multi-range fragment (yet).
Before trying it, I thought that if you wanted to create a
molecule by atom selection (aka Copy Fragment), you could use:
(1-50,75-100,150-200)
But now I tried it, that doesn't seem to work. Baah.
I don't know if that is a feature or a bug.
The (mmdb) atom selection (as used in Coot) is described here;
